KnightX Holdings Co., Ltd. has delivered samples of next-generation flash memory chips to major AI data center operators, aiming to outpace competitors in this lucrative market. The chip manufacturer based in Tokyo has introduced a new high-density 3D flash memory chip specifically designed to meet the needs of AI data centers, offering higher storage density, faster data transfer speeds, and superior energy efficiency. KnightX announced on Friday that this new storage product will be integrated into its data center solid-state drives, which will be produced at a new production line located at the North factory in Iwate, Japan. The chip features a 332-layer stack design, allowing a single silicon chip to accommodate larger data capacities. The new facility will help KnightX increase production capacity to meet the explosive data storage demands of AI service providers. The factory will simultaneously mass produce the outstanding ninth-generation low-cost flash memory chips and the tenth-generation new products. KnightX's main competitors in the data center and mobile flash memory markets include South Korea's Samsung Electronics, SK Hynix, and Micron Technology based in Boise, Idaho, USA.
